Plantation cultivation in the Caribbean, Central and South America

In the 15th and 16th centuries, Portuguese colonists started banana plantations in the Atlantic Islands, Brazil, and western Africa. North Americans began consuming bananas on a small scale at very high prices shortly after the Civil War, though it was only in the 1880s that the food became more widespread. As late as the Victorian Era, bananas were not widely known in Europe, although they were available. Jules Verne introduces bananas to his readers with detailed descriptions in ''Around the World in Eighty Days'' (1872). The earliest modern plantations originated in Jamaica and the related Western Caribbean Zone, including most of Central America. It involved the combination of modern transportation networks of steamships and railroads with the development of refrigeration that allowed more time between harvesting and ripening. North American shippers like Lorenzo Dow Baker and Andrew Preston, the founders of the Boston Fruit Company started this process in the 1870s, but railroad builders like Minor C. Keith also participated, eventually culminating in the multi-national giant corporations like today's Chiquita Brands International and Dole Food Company, Dole. These companies were monopoly, monopolistic, vertically integrated (meaning they controlled growing, processing, shipping and marketing) and usually used political manipulation to build enclave economy, enclave economies (economies that were internally self-sufficient, virtually tax exempt, and export-oriented that contribute very little to the host economy). Their political maneuvers, which gave rise to the term banana republic for states such as Honduras and Guatemala, included working with local elites and their rivalries to influence politics or playing the international interests of the United States, especially during the Cold War, to keep the political climate favorable to their interests.


Peasant cultivation for export in the Caribbean

The vast majority of the world's bananas today are cultivated for family consumption or for sale on local markets. India is the world leader in this sort of production, but many other Asian and African countries where climate and soil conditions allow cultivation also host large populations of banana growers who sell at least some of their crop. Peasant sector banana growers produce for the world market in the Caribbean, however. The Windward Islands are notable for the growing, largely of Cavendish bananas, for an international market, generally in Europe but also in North America. In the Caribbean, and especially in Dominica where this sort of cultivation is widespread, holdings are in the 1–2 acre range. In many cases the farmer earns additional money from other crops, from engaging in labor outside the farm, and from a share of the earnings of relatives living overseas. Banana crops are vulnerable to destruction by high winds, such as tropical storms or cyclones.


Modern cultivation

All widely cultivated bananas today descend from the two wild bananas ''Musa acuminata'' and ''Musa balbisiana''. While the original wild bananas contained large seeds, diploid or polyploid cultivars (some being Hybrid (biology), hybrids) with tiny seeds or triploid hybrids without seeds are preferred for human raw fruit consumption, as banana seeds are large and hard and spiky and liable to crack teeth. These are propagated asexual reproduction, asexually from offshoots. The plant is allowed to produce two shoots at a time; a larger one for immediate fruiting and a smaller "sucker" or "follower" to produce fruit in 6–8 months. As a non-seasonal crop, bananas are available fresh year-round.


Cavendish

In global commerce in 2009, by far the most important cultivars belonged to the triploid List of banana cultivars#AAA Group, AAA cultivar group, group of ''Musa acuminata'', commonly referred to as Cavendish group bananas. They accounted for the majority of banana exports, despite only coming into existence in 1836. The cultivars Dwarf Cavendish and Grand Nain (Chiquita Banana) gained popularity in the 1950s after the previous mass-produced cultivar, Gros Michel banana, Gros Michel (also an AAA group cultivar), became commercially unviable due to Panama disease, caused by the fungus ''Fusarium oxysporum'' which attacks the roots of the banana plant. Cavendish cultivars are resistant to the Panama disease, but in 2013 there were fears that the black sigatoka fungus would in turn make Cavendish bananas unviable. Even though it is no longer viable for large scale cultivation, Gros Michel is not extinct and is still grown in areas where Panama disease is not found. Likewise, Dwarf Cavendish and Grand Nain are in no danger of extinction, but they may leave supermarket shelves if disease makes it impossible to supply the global market. It is unclear if any existing cultivar can replace Cavendish bananas, so various Hybrid (biology), hybridisation and genetic engineering programs are attempting to create a disease-resistant, mass-market banana. One such strain that has emerged is the Taiwanese Cavendish, also known as the Formosana.


Ripening

Export bananas are picked green, and ripen in special rooms upon arrival in the destination country. These rooms are air-tight and filled with Ethylene as a plant hormone, ethylene gas to induce ripening. The vivid yellow color consumers normally associate with supermarket bananas is, in fact, caused by the artificial ripening process. Flavor and texture are also affected by ripening temperature. Bananas are refrigerated to between during transport. At lower temperatures, ripening permanently stalls, and the bananas turn gray as cell walls break down. The skin of ripe bananas quickly blackens in the environment of a domestic refrigerator, although the fruit inside remains unaffected. Bananas can be ordered by the retailer "ungassed" (''i.e.'' not treated with ethylene), and may show up at the supermarket fully green. (green bananas) that have not been gassed will never fully ripen before becoming rotten. Instead of fresh eating, these bananas can be used for cooking, as seen in Jamaican cuisine. A 2008 study reported that ripe bananas fluoresce when exposed to ultraviolet light. This property is attributed to the degradation of chlorophyll leading to the accumulation of a fluorescent product in the skin of the fruit. The chlorophyll breakdown product is stabilized by a propionate ester group. Banana-plant leaves also fluoresce in the same way. Green (under-ripe) bananas do not fluoresce. That paper suggested that this fluorescence could be put to use "for optical in vivo monitoring of ripening and over-ripening of bananas and other fruit".


Storage and transport

Bananas must be transported over long distances from the tropics to world markets. To obtain maximum shelf life, harvest comes before the fruit is mature. The fruit requires careful handling, rapid transport to ports, cooling, and refrigerated shipping. The goal is to prevent the bananas from producing their natural ripening agent, ethylene. This technology allows storage and transport for 3–4 weeks at . On arrival, bananas are held at about and treated with a low concentration of ethylene. After a few days, the fruit begins to ripen and is distributed for final sale. Ripe bananas can be held for a few days at home. If bananas are too green, they can be put in a brown paper bag with an apple or tomato overnight to speed up the ripening process. Carbon dioxide (which bananas produce) and ethylene absorbents extend fruit life even at high temperatures. This effect can be exploited by packing banana in a polyethylene bag and including an ethylene absorbent, e.g., potassium permanganate, on an inert carrier. The bag is then sealed with a band or string. This treatment has been shown to more than double lifespans up to 3–4 weeks without the need for refrigeration.


Sustainability

The excessive use of fertilizers often left in abandoned plantations contributes greatly to eutrophication in local streams and lakes, and harms aquatic life after algal blooms deprive fish of oxygen. It has been theorized that destruction of 60% of coral reefs along the coasts of Costa Rica is partially from sediments from banana plantations. Another issue is the deforestation associated with expanding banana production. As monocultures rapidly deplete soil nutrients plantations expand to areas with rich soils and cut down forests, which also affects soil erosion and degradation, and increases frequency of flooding. The World Wildlife Fund (WWF) stated that banana production produced more waste than any other agricultural sector, mostly from discarded banana plants, bags used to cover the bananas, strings to tie them, and containers for transport. Sustainability standards and certification, Voluntary sustainability standards such as Rainforest Alliance and Fairtrade certification, Fairtrade are increasingly being used to address some of these issues. Bananas production certified by such sustainability standards experienced a 43% compound annual growth rate from 2008 to 2016, to represent 36% of banana exports.


Production and export

In 2017, world production of bananas and plantains combined was 153 million tonnes, led by India and China with a combined total of 27% of global production. Other major producers were the Philippines, Colombia, Indonesia, Ecuador, and Brazil. As reported for 2013, total world exports were 20 million tonnes of bananas and 859,000 tonnes of plantains. Ecuador and the Philippines were the leading exporters with 5.4 and 3.3 million tonnes, respectively, and the Dominican Republic was the leading exporter of plantains with 210,350 tonnes.


Developing countries

Bananas and plantains constitute a major staple agriculture, food crop for millions of people in developing country, developing countries. In many tropical countries, green (unripe) bananas used for cooking represent the main cultivars. Most producers are small-scale farmers either for home consumption or local markets. Because bananas and plantains produce fruit year-round, they provide a valuable food source during the ''hunger season'' (when the food from one annual/semi-annual harvest has been consumed, and the next is still to come). Bananas and plantains are important for global food security.


Pests, diseases, and natural disasters

Although in no danger of outright extinction, the most common edible banana cultivar Cavendish (extremely popular in Europe and the Americas) could become unviable for large-scale cultivation in the next 10–20 years. Its predecessor 'Gros Michel', discovered in the 1820s, suffered this fate. Like almost all bananas, Cavendish lacks genetic diversity, which makes it vulnerable to diseases, threatening both commercial cultivation and small-scale subsistence farming. Within the data gathered from the genes of hundreds of bananas, Botanist, Julie Sardos, of the Bioversity International research group, along with her colleagues found proof that at least several wild banana ancestors exist that are currently unknown to scientists, which could provide a means of defense against banana crop diseases. Some commentators remarked that those variants which could replace what much of the world considers a "typical banana" are so different that most people would not consider them the same fruit, and blame the decline of the banana on mendelian inheritance, monogenetic cultivation driven by short-term commercial motives. Overall, fungal banana disease, fungal diseases are disproportionately important to small island developing states.


Panama disease

Panama disease is caused by a fusarium soil fungus (Race 1), which enters the plants through the roots and travels with water into the trunk and leaves, producing gels and gums that cut off the flow of water and nutrients, causing the plant to wilting, wilt, and exposing the rest of the plant to lethal amounts of sunlight. Prior to 1960, almost all commercial banana production centered on "Gros Michel", which was highly susceptible. Cavendish was chosen as the replacement for Gros Michel because, among resistant cultivars, it produces the highest quality
fruit In botany, a fruit is the seed-bearing structure in flowering plants that is formed from the ovary after flowering. Fruits are the means by which flowering plants (also known as angiosperms) disseminate their seeds. Edible fruits in particu ...
. However, more care is required for shipping the Cavendish, and its quality compared to Gros Michel is debated. According to current sources, a deadly form of Panama disease is infecting Cavendish. All plants are genetically identical, which prevents evolution of disease resistance. Researchers are examining hundreds of wild varieties for resistance.


Tropical race 4

Tropical Race 4 (TR4), a reinvigorated strain of Panama disease, was first discovered in 1993. This virulent form of fusarium wilt destroyed Cavendish in several southeast Asian countries and spread to Australia and India. As the soil-based fungi can easily be carried on boots, clothing, or tools, the wilt spread to the Americas despite years of preventive efforts. Cavendish is highly susceptible to TR4, and over time, Cavendish is endangered for commercial production by this disease. The only known defense to TR4 is Plant disease resistance, genetic resistance. This is conferred either by RGA2, a gene isolated from a TR4-resistant diploid banana, or by the nematode-derived Ced9. This is best achieved by genetic modification, such as in the Dale banana disclosed in Dale ''et al.'', 2017. Experts state the need to enrich banana biodiversity by producing diverse new banana varieties, not just having a focus on the Cavendish.


Black sigatoka

Black sigatoka is a fungal leaf spot disease first observed in Fiji in 1963 or 1964. Black Sigatoka (also known as black leaf streak) has spread to banana plantations throughout the tropics from infected banana leaves that were used as packing material. It affects all main cultivars of bananas and plantains (including the Cavendish cultivars), impeding photosynthesis by blackening parts of the leaves, eventually killing the entire leaf. Starved for energy, fruit production falls by 50% or more, and the bananas that do grow ripening, ripen prematurely, making them unsuitable for export. The fungus has shown ever-increasing resistance to treatment, with the current expense for treating exceeding US$1,000 per year. In addition to the expense, there is the question of how long intensive spraying can be environmentally justified.

Banana bacterial wilt

Banana Xanthomonas wilt, Banana bacterial wilt (BBW) is a bacterial disease caused by ''Xanthomonas campestris'' pv. ''musacearum''. After being originally identified on a close relative of bananas, ''Ensete ventricosum'', in Ethiopia in the 1960s, BBW occurred in Uganda in 2001 affecting all banana cultivars. Since then BBW has been diagnosed in Central and East Africa including the banana growing regions of Rwanda, the Democratic Republic of the Congo, Tanzania, Kenya, Burundi, and Uganda.


Conservation

Given the narrow range of genetic diversity present in bananas and the many threats via Biotic component, biotic (pests and diseases) and Abiotic component, abiotic (such as drought) stress, Conservation biology, conservation of the full spectrum of banana plant genetic resources, genetic resources is ongoing. Banana germplasm is conserved in many national and regional gene banks, and at the world's largest banana collection, the International ''Musa'' Germplasm Transit Centre (ITC), managed by Bioversity International and hosted at KU Leuven in Belgium. ''Musa'' cultivars are usually seedless, and options for their long-term conservation are constrained by the vegetative nature of the plant's reproductive system. Consequently, they are conserved by three main methods: ''in vivo'' (planted in field collections), ''in vitro'' (as plantlets in test tubes within a controlled environment), and by cryopreservation (meristems conserved in liquid nitrogen at −196 °C). At the Honduran Foundation for Agricultural Research there were attempts to exploit the rare cases of seed production to create disease-resistant varieties; 30,000 commercial banana plants were hand-pollinated with pollen from wild fertile Asian fruit, producing 400 tonnes, which contained about fiftenn seeds, of which four or five germinated." Further breeding with wild bananas yielded a new seedless variety resistant to both black Sigatoka and Panama disease. Genes from wild banana species are conserved as DNA and as cryopreserved pollen and banana seeds from wild species are also conserved, although less commonly, as they are difficult to regenerate. In addition, bananas and their crop wild relatives are conserved ''in situ'' (in wild natural habitats where they evolved and continue to do so). Diversity is also conserved in farmers' fields where continuous cultivation, adaptation and improvement of cultivars is often carried out by small-scale farmers growing traditional local cultivars.


Nutrition

Raw bananas (not including the peel) are 75% water, 23% carbohydrates, 1% protein, and contain negligible fat. A 100-gram reference serving supplies 89 Calories, 31% of the US recommended Daily Value (DV) of Vitamin B6, vitamin B6, and moderate amounts of vitamin C, manganese and dietary fiber, with no other micronutrients in significant content (see table).


Potassium

Although bananas are commonly thought to contain exceptional potassium content, their actual potassium content is not high per typical food serving, having only 8% of the US recommended Daily Value for potassium (considered a low level of the DV, see nutrition table), and their potassium-content ranking among fruits, vegetables, legumes, and many other foods is relatively moderate. Vegetables with higher potassium content than raw dessert bananas (358 mg per 100 g) include raw spinach (558 mg per 100 g), baked potatoes without skin (391 mg per 100 g), cooked soybeans (539 mg per 100 g), grilled portabella mushrooms (437 mg per 100 g), and processed tomato sauces (413–439 mg per 100 g). Raw plantains contain 499 mg potassium per 100 g. Dehydrated dessert bananas or banana powder contain 1491 mg potassium per 100 g.

Culture


Food and cooking


Fruit

Bananas are a staple
starch Starch or amylum is a polymeric carbohydrate consisting of numerous glucose units joined by glycosidic bonds. This polysaccharide is produced by most green plants for energy storage. Worldwide, it is the most common carbohydrate in human diets ...
for many tropical populations. Depending upon cultivar and ripeness, the flesh can vary in taste from starchy to sweet, and texture from firm to mushy. Both the skin and inner part can be eaten raw or cooked. The primary component of the aroma of fresh bananas is isoamyl acetate (also known as ''banana oil''), which, along with several other compounds such as butyl acetate and isobutyl acetate, is a significant contributor to banana flavor. During the ripening process, bananas produce the gas Ethylene as a plant hormone, ethylene, which acts as a plant hormone and indirectly affects the flavor. Among other things, ethylene stimulates the formation of amylase, an enzyme that breaks down starch into sugar, influencing the taste of bananas. The greener, less ripe bananas contain higher levels of starch and, consequently, have a "starchier" taste. On the other hand, yellow bananas taste sweeter due to higher sugar concentrations. Furthermore, ethylene signals the production of pectinase, an enzyme which breaks down the pectin between the cells of the banana, causing the banana to soften as it ripens. Flower

Banana flowers (also called "banana hearts" or "banana blossoms") are used as a vegetable in South Asian cuisine, South Asian and Southeast Asian cuisine, either raw or steamed with dips or cooked in soups, curries and fried foods. The flavor resembles that of artichoke. As with artichokes, both the fleshy part of the bracts and the heart are edible.

Fiber


Textiles

File:COLLECTIE TROPENMUSEUM Het verpakken van manilla-hennep (musa textilis) in balen op onderneming Kali Telepak Besoeki Oost-Java TMnr 10011535.jpg, The packaging of Manila hemp (Musa textilis) into bales at Kali Telepak, Besoeki, East Java File:48-QWSTION-BANANATEX-LOOM-LAUSCHSICHT.jpg, Weaving looms processing Manila hemp fabric File:QWSTION Flap tote small.jpg, An example of a modern Manila hemp bag produced by the fashion company QWSTION Banana fiber harvested from the pseudostems and leaves of the plant has been used for textiles in Asia since at least the 13th century. Both fruit-bearing and fibrous varieties of the banana plant have been used. In the Japanese system Kijōka-bashōfu, leaves and shoots are cut from the plant periodically to ensure softness. Harvested shoots are first boiled in lye to prepare fibers for yarn-making. These banana shoots produce fibers of varying degrees of softness, yielding yarns and textiles with differing qualities for specific uses. For example, the outermost fibers of the shoots are the coarsest, and are suitable for tablecloths, while the softest innermost fibers are desirable for kimono and hakama, kamishimo. This traditional Japanese cloth-making process requires many steps, all performed by hand. In India, a banana fiber separator machine has been developed, which takes the agricultural waste of local banana harvests and extracts strands of the fiber.


Paper

Banana fiber is used in the production of banana paper. Banana paper is made from two different parts: the bark (botany), bark of the banana plant, mainly used for artistic purposes, or from the fibers of the stem and non-usable fruits. The paper is either hand-made or by industrial process.

Religion and popular beliefs

In India, bananas serve a prominent part in many festivals and occasions of Hindus. In South Indian weddings, particularly Tamil culture, Tamil weddings, banana trees are tied in pairs to form an arch as a blessing to the couple for a long-lasting, useful life. In Thailand, it is believed that Musa balbisiana, a certain type of banana plant may be inhabited by a spirit, Nang Tani, a type of ghost related to trees and similar plants that manifests itself as a young woman. Often people tie a length of colored satin cloth around the pseudostem of the banana plants. In Ethnic Malays, Malay folklore, the ghost known as Pontianak (folklore), Pontianak is associated with banana plants (''pokok pisang''), and its spirit is said to reside in them during the day.


Racist symbol

There is a long racist history of describing people of African descent as being more like monkeys than humans, and due to the assumption in popular culture that monkeys like bananas, bananas have been used in symbolic acts of hate speech. Particularly in Europe, bananas have long been commonly thrown at black footballers by racist spectators. In April 2014, during a match at Villarreal CF, Villarreal's stadium, Estadio de la Cerámica, El Madrigal, Dani Alves was targeted by Villareal supporter David Campaya Lleo, who threw a banana at him. Alves picked up the banana, peeled it and took a bite, and the meme went viral on social media in support of him. Racist taunts are an ongoing problem in football. Bananas were hung from nooses around the campus of American University in May 2017 after the student body elected its first black woman student government president. "Banana (slur), Banana" is also a Pejorative, slur aimed at some Asian people, that are said to be "yellow on the outside, white on the inside". Used primarily by East or Southeast Asians for other East/Southeast Asians or Asian Americans who are perceived as assimilated into mainstream American culture.
